Output 08f3b8e683e520728da2fd0996dd1ebb990fd1d68e20158c9f24e2f6540ab02a:0

value
81748954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571b012d4ec2a13cec85289f25f6d4c1f6243099 OP_EQUAL
address
39db4Yam2a1wNKYkefKRKPWEknYT7Hp7M6
transaction
08f3b8e683e520728da2fd0996dd1ebb990fd1d68e20158c9f24e2f6540ab02a
confirmations
233101
spent
true